The Joseph Henry Edmondson Foundation serves the Pikes Peak Region. While grants have been awarded outside this geographic area under unique circumstances, most funding is confined to supporting those nonprofits in Colorado Springs. In general, all grants must follow the Foundation’s mission or have direct relevance.
Focus Areas
- Youth Organizations
- Animal Welfare
- Arts
- Health and Human Services
- Community Building
- Education
- Environment
Funding Information
Grants range from $500 – $100,000 with an average of $10,000.
Eligibility Criteria
All organizations applying to the Foundation must be a nonprofit, tax-exempt 501(c)(3) organization; or be a project or organization under the fiscal agency of a 501(c)3 organization.
Ineligibility Criteria
The Foundation does not support the following:
- Organizations that have not secured their legal 501(c)(3) designation from the IRS or are not under the fiscal agency of a nonprofit
- Individuals
- Special and/or Fundraising Events
- Debt Reduction
- Organizations with an evangelical mission
Note that while the Foundation does support public education, this area is solely funded via proactive initiatives. Therefore, unsolicited proposals will not be considered.
